Action selector is the attribute that can be applied to the action methods. It helps the routing engine to select the correct action method to handle a particular request. MVC 5 includes the following action selector attributes:
1.ActionName:
The ActionName attribute allows us to specify a different action name than the method name

2.NonAction
Use the NonAction attribute when you want public method in a controller but do not want to treat it as an action method.
